In-depth review: Adbot
Adbot positions itself as a hands-off search ads manager for small businesses, automating budget allocation and campaign optimization across Google and Bing, with added Google Business Profile management. The core thesis is that AI can outperform manual PPC management by dynamically shifting spend to the highest-performing platform, reducing wasted ad spend, and freeing business owners to focus on growth. This is a compelling pitch for startups, freelancers, and in-house teams that lack the time or expertise to manage search ads themselves. However, the real-world value depends on how well the automation aligns with a business's specific goals, budget, and tolerance for relinquishing control.
Where Adbot stands out is in its automated budget reallocation across platforms for optimal clicks. Rather than setting fixed budgets per channel, the tool monitors performance in real time and shifts spending where it generates the most clicks. This is particularly useful for businesses with limited ad budgets that need every rand to count. Additionally, the Google Business Profile synchronization and review response automation is a practical time-saver for local businesses. Adbot automatically syncs GBP with website updates and responds to reviews, though the risk of templated replies may undermine authenticity. The reported 9% CTR (vs. 3% industry average) is eye-catching, but it is based on user reports rather than independent verification, so it should be taken with caution.
The tool fits best into a workflow where the user wants minimal daily involvement but still needs to monitor performance at a high level. The 'Do It Yourself' tier (R600/month) gives access to the tech while the user monitors performance, and the bot handles optimization and budgets. This is ideal for marketing professionals or entrepreneurs who understand PPC basics but want to offload routine tasks. The 'Done For You' tier (R2200/month) adds human PPC experts who manage setup and results, which may appeal to businesses that want a fully managed solution but should be weighed against the cost of hiring a freelance specialist. The ad spend itself is separate (minimum R1500), which can make the total cost confusing.
Who benefits most are startups and freelancers who lack time for manual PPC management, in-house marketing teams seeking to offload routine optimization, and small e-commerce businesses wanting to capture search intent without hiring an agency. However, the tool's limitations matter: it currently supports only Google Ads and Bing Ads, with social media ad A/B testing on a waiting list and not yet available. For businesses that rely heavily on Facebook or Instagram advertising, Adbot is not a complete solution. Additionally, the automation may limit granular control: advanced users who want to adjust keyword match types, ad copy variants, or bidding strategies manually may find the tool too restrictive.
A practical buyer should start with the DIY tier to test the automation, then upgrade to managed only if the results justify the cost. It is also wise to run a small parallel manual campaign to benchmark Adbot's performance claims. The tool's 24/7 campaign management and optimization is algorithm-driven, involving bid adjustments, ad rotation, and budget pacing, but human oversight is still needed for strategic decisions like targeting new keywords or adjusting landing pages. The multi-channel dashboard is convenient, but the absence of other channels means it is not a true all-in-one platform.
In summary, Adbot is a focused tool for automated search ads, particularly strong for budget-conscious small businesses that want to capture search intent without daily management. Its strengths are real, but its limitations—especially the missing social ad features and reliance on user-reported results—mean it should be evaluated with a clear understanding of what it can and cannot do. For the right user, it can be a cost-effective way to improve ad performance; for others, it may feel like an incomplete solution.

Frequently asked questions
How does Adbot's pricing work? Is there a setup fee?Pricing
Adbot offers three tiers: a DIY plan at R600/month, a Done For You plan at R2200/month, and a separate Google Ad Spend budget starting at R1500. There is no setup fee (list price R1500 waived). Billing is 30 days in advance, and ad spend is deducted per click.
Can I use Adbot for social media ads like Facebook or Instagram?Limitations
Currently, Adbot only manages Google Ads, Bing Ads, and Google Business Profile. Social media ad A/B testing is on a waiting list and not yet available. So you cannot run Facebook or Instagram ads through Adbot at this time.
What kind of results can I realistically expect from Adbot?General
Adbot reports a 9% click-through rate (CTR) from users, compared to the 3% industry average. However, results vary based on industry, budget, and campaign settings. The 9% figure is user-reported, not independently verified.
How does Adbot handle Google Business Profile reviews?Workflow
Adbot automatically responds to new reviews using AI-generated replies. It also syncs your GBP with your website to ensure consistency. The automation saves time, but replies may lack personalization.
Is Adbot suitable for a business with a very small ad budget?Fit
Yes, Adbot's DIY plan at R600/month is affordable for small budgets. However, you also need to fund ad spend (minimum R1500). The tool optimizes to get the most clicks per rand, making it suitable for tight budgets, but you should monitor performance regularly.
Does Adbot integrate with other marketing tools or platforms?Integration
Adbot integrates natively with Google Ads, Bing Ads, and Google Business Profile. There is no mention of integrations with CRM, analytics, or other marketing platforms. For social media, only a waiting list for A/B testing exists.
